The anatomical origin of dimples
The explanation of these cavities begins in a specific muscle of the face: the zygomaticus major. Its usual function is to raise the corners of the lips when we smile, allowing that universal expression of joy. However, in certain people this muscle presents a very particular structural variation: it is divided into two independent fascicles or muscle bundles.
This bifurcation causes that, when contracting during the smile, the skin is tractioned unevenly. The result is that small visible depression in the cheek that we call a dimple. It is, therefore, a congenital peculiarity of muscle tissue, not a defect or a medical condition.
The role of subcutaneous tissue
Muscle anatomy is not the only determining factor. The thickness of the fat layer under the skin also has a decisive influence on the visibility of the dimple. When the adipose tissue is thinner, the cleft is marked more clearly. On the other hand, on faces with fuller cheeks, the dimple may fade or even disappear completely. This explains why some people notice how their dimples become more or less apparent based on weight changes throughout life.
A genetic inheritance that follows its own rules
If you have dimples, there’s a good chance you inherited them from one of your parents. Genetics specialists explain that this trait is transmitted under a pattern called autosomal dominant. In simple terms, this means that it is enough for only one of the parents to carry this characteristic for there to be a high probability that it will manifest itself in the children.
However, human genetics does not always behave like a perfect manual. There are cases of people who develop dimples without an obvious family history, as well as inverse situations in which they become blurred over the years. The skin’s natural loss of elasticity during aging can modify the appearance of these marks, making them less noticeable or changing their shape.
A surprising distribution in the world
Although many consider dimples to be an uncommon trait, statistics tell another story. Various studies carried out in different regions of the planet show striking figures on their presence:
- In Greece, about one in eight children has dimples on their cheeks.
- In certain communities in Nigeria, the prevalence exceeds 50% of the population.
- In other regions, the numbers vary considerably, with differences in both the frequency and location and shape of the indentations.
These geographical differences are explained by the combination of genetic factors specific to each population and marriage practices within specific communities. When certain genes are concentrated in a group, their physical characteristics—including dimples—tend to manifest more frequently among its members.
Myths and popular beliefs
Around dimples there are numerous cultural beliefs. In some traditions they are considered a symbol of good luck, special beauty or even blessing. Other cultures attribute meanings related to the character or destiny of those who possess them.
Nonetheless, science remains firm in its position: there is no evidence to support these ideas. Dimples are simply an anatomical feature, certainly attractive to many, but without any specific biological function. They do not indicate health, personality or fortune. Its value is purely aesthetic and cultural.
Can dimples be artificially created?
For those who dream of having dimples, cosmetic surgery offers an option called dimpleplasty. This procedure involves creating a small adhesion between the muscle and the skin of the cheek to simulate the appearance of an indentation when smiling. Although the technique is real and accessible, it has certain important limitations.
The result never manages to accurately reproduce the naturalness of a genuine dimple. In addition, like any surgical intervention, it carries risks: infections, visible scars, asymmetries or permanent results that may not coincide with what is expected.
